Rob RaywardRob Rayward, an RCVS Orthopaedic Specialist at Davies Veterinary Specialists, Hertfordshire, is preparing to grease up and swim the murky waters of the English Channel this month, to raise funds for the Christian charity Derek Prince Ministries UK.

Rob is undertaking the 35km swim as a part of a Channel Swim Relay Team and has been in training for his chilly trip across one of the world's busiest shipping lanes for the past year. He is hoping to raise £1500 for the charity, which provides Christian teaching materials in over 1000 languages to Church leaders and Christian communities around the world. They also provide food and education to poor widows and orphans in Ethiopia.

Rob said: "Despite being a small animal vet I'm definitely not planning on doing the doggy paddle. All members of the team have different strengths and weaknesses but for me the cold water is proving to be a real challenge. It is likely to be about 16C on the day but as well as the cold we may have to swim part of it in the dark. Many people are aware that the Channel has debris floating in it but few are aware that we may also face jelly fish, basking sharks and if really lucky, sewage! We anticipate it taking us approximately 14 hours to complete the crossing but weather and tidal conditions can have a major impact on our time."

Rob will be completing his challenge when the conditions are favourable at some point between 19th and 28th July.
